I interviewed with them last year, its the same thing as any LTL carrier, your on call, you work the dock, you run terminal to terminal one day, city P&D the next,
Not saying this is a bad thing, ABF, Conway, Yellow, etc pay a ### load of money to their drivers, its just how you start out...
ABF is union, if they hire you they will send you to Arkansas (I think it was were he said) for orientation and training (I beleive it was like 3 weeks or so)
this is even for city drivers...
Good Luck with them, as I said, it will seriously suck in the beginning but after some time on the board you'll be making some big money !!!! -
First thing they will ask you is what ABF stands for.
-
If they are like roadway was we had a booklet of like 20+ pages that asked many questions which were duplicate but worded differently to try and trick you mostly about theft and a bunch toward matching numbers to see if you will get trailers mixed up with similar numbers.
Arkansas Best Freight
